The Role of Phlebotomists in Healthcare

Phlebotomists are healthcare professionals trained to collect blood samples from patients for various medical tests and procedures. They play a vital role in the healthcare system by ensuring that accurate and reliable blood samples are collected and processed for diagnostic purposes. Phlebotomists work in a variety of settings, including hospitals, clinics, diagnostic laboratories, and other healthcare facilities. Their primary responsibilities include:

  1. Identifying patients and verifying their information
  2. Explaining procedures to patients and ensuring their comfort
  3. Collecting blood samples using various techniques
  4. Labeling and storing samples correctly
  5. Ensuring the integrity and quality of collected samples

The Impact of AI on Phlebotomy

Artificial Intelligence is transforming the way phlebotomists perform their day-to-day tasks. AI technologies can assist phlebotomists in various aspects of their work, including:

Vein Detection

One of the essential skills for a phlebotomist is the ability to locate and access a patient's veins for blood collection accurately. AI tools, such as vein imaging devices, can help phlebotomists identify suitable veins quickly and efficiently. These devices use infrared light to highlight the veins, making it easier for phlebotomists to perform successful Venipuncture on the first try. By enhancing vein detection, AI technology can reduce patient discomfort and improve the overall phlebotomy experience.

Sample Analysis

Once blood samples are collected, they need to be analyzed in the laboratory to provide valuable medical insights. AI-powered algorithms can analyze blood samples more quickly and accurately than traditional methods, reducing the turnaround time for Test Results. AI can also help identify patterns and trends in the data, enabling Healthcare Providers to make more informed decisions about patient care. By automating the analysis process, AI technology enhances the efficiency and reliability of laboratory testing.

Patient Data Management

Phlebotomists are responsible for documenting and maintaining accurate records of patient information and Test Results. AI systems can streamline the data management process by capturing and organizing patient data in Electronic Health Records (EHRs). These systems can automatically input Test Results, flag abnormal values, and generate reports for Healthcare Providers. By digitizing patient data, AI technology improves data accuracy, accessibility, and security, ultimately enhancing the quality of patient care.

Challenges and Considerations

While AI technology offers numerous benefits to phlebotomists and healthcare facilities, several challenges and considerations must be addressed:

  1. Training and Education: Phlebotomists need to receive proper training and education on how to effectively use AI tools in their daily practice. It is essential for phlebotomists to understand how AI technology works, how to interpret the results it provides, and how to troubleshoot any issues that may arise.
  2. Regulatory Compliance: Healthcare organizations must ensure that AI systems comply with regulatory standards, such as HIPAA (Health Insurance Portability and Accountability Act) Regulations. Patient data privacy and security must be maintained when using AI technology in phlebotomy practices.
  3. Interprofessional Collaboration: AI technology should complement, not replace, the skills and expertise of healthcare professionals. Interprofessional collaboration between phlebotomists, laboratory technicians, nurses, and other Healthcare Providers is essential to maximize the benefits of AI in phlebotomy.
